This is a drawing of two masked figures engaging in a sword fight. The image shows two elaborately costumed characters with large hats and feathers dueling with swords. Both figures are standing in a dynamic pose as they cross swords. In the background, there are sketch-like outlines of bystanders watching the duel, along with some trees and an architectural structure. The style is reminiscent of theatrical or comedia dell'arte costumes, reflected in the exaggerated clothing and dramatic stances of the figures. The words "Taglia Cantoni" and "Fracasso" are inscribed underneath the characters. The drawing emphasizes motion and dramatic expression.
